Customer quotes |
Andrey Torzhkov, Research Scientist at Siemens Corporate Research "It's been a positive experience for Siemens Corporate Research dealing with Ateji and using OptimJ." said Andrey Torzhkov, Research Scientist. "We've succesfully applied OptimJ to improve an existing software application developed in one of our past numerical optimization projects. Now, we're going to deploy OptimJ capabilities for our ongoing Java-based projects to close a gap between optimization engines & modeling applications". Martin Markoff, WWU Munster university"We are pretty enthusiastic about OptimJ because it provides us the opportunity to describe our optimization problem in a mathematical way.
Nevertheless it is very similar to Java programming. This pretty efficient way of formulating optimization problems leads to economy of time compared to the formulation in any specific matrix form. " Médéric Suon, Industrial Engineer at PSA Peugeot Citroën."Using OptimJ enabled a rapid development and integration of optimization models in Java-based applications. Even better, OptimJ made it easy to use results from different solvers and combine exact methods with metaheuristics coded in Java, for solving complex industrial problems."
Lucas Letocart, Associate professor at University Paris 13"I use OptimJ for teaching a master and an engineer course. Students become quickly proficient in the language and its IDE, and appreciate the ease of implementation and integration".
Luc Mercier from Brown University"I used OptimJ to implement a model for production planning in a polystyrene factory.", says Luc Mercier from Brown University. "The main program needed to call many times the IP solver, making the use of traditional modeling languages difficult. I would have used ILOG Concert™ Java API if I hadn't encountered OptimJ. What a time saver!"
Luc created Amsaa, an algorithm for online stochastic combinatorial optimization that scales thousands of time better than a multistage stochastic programming approach. He explains why he chose OptimJ: "The code is several times more compact than the Concert equivalent, and definitely clearer. And there is no functionality loss since the underlying API is still available when needed (e.g., to use the solution pool). All in all, you get the expressiveness of OPL™ with the integrability and flexibility of Concert -- the best of both worlds." David Gravot, consulting expert in optimization and founder of Rostudel"With OptimJ, ATEJI now supports all the common features available in algebraic modeling languages", says David Gravot, consulting expert in optimization and founder of Rostudel.
"Integrating optimization projects in a Java environment becomes a breeze using the Eclipse IDE, shortening project development times up to 50%". |
Customer Quotes
We're going to deploy OptimJ capabilities for our ongoing Java-based projects to close a gap between optimization engines and Java applications.
With OptimJ you get the expressiveness of OPL™ with the integrability and flexibility of Ilog Concert™ -- the best of both worlds.
Integrating optimization projects in a Java environment becomes a breeze using the Eclipse IDE, shortening project development times up to 50%.
OptimJ made it easy to use results from different solvers and combine exact methods with metaheuristics coded in Java, for solving complex industrial problems.
I used OptimJ to implement a model for production planning in a polystyrene factory.
We've succesfully applied OptimJ to improve an existing software application developed in one of our past numerical optimization projects.
Using OptimJ enabled a rapid development and integration of optimization models in Java-based applications.



